Medical Cond Aggravated By Exposure: EYE & SKIN CONDITIONS First Aid: EYES: IMMEDIATELY FLUSH W/WATER FOR 15 MINS. SKIN: WASH THOROUGHLY W/SOAP & WATER. INGESTION: GIVE LARGE AMOUNTS OF WATER. INDUCE VOMITING UNDER DIRECTION OF PHYSICIAN. OBTAIN MEDICAL ATTENTION IN ALL CASES. ======================================================= Handling and Disposal ======================================================= Spill Release Procedures: ABSORB W/VERMICULITE/OTHER INERT MATERIAL. CONTAINERIZE FOR LATER DISPOSAL. Waste Disposal Methods: DISPOSE OF BY INCINERATION/OTHER METHOD IAW/FEDERAL, STATE & LOCAL REGULATIONS. Handling And Storage Precautions: STORE IN A COOL, DRY AREA. AVOID DIRECT SUNLIGHT. Other Precautions: AVOID CONTACT W/EYES, SKIN & CLOTHING. AVOID BREATHINGCHEMICAL. ======================================================= Fire and Explosion Hazard Information ======================================================= Extinguishing Media: DRY CHEMICAL, CO2, WATER SPRAY/FOAM. Fire Fighting Procedures: WEAR SELF CONTAINED POSITIVE PRESSURE BREATHING APPARATUS & FULL PROTECTIVE CLOTHING. ======================================================= Control Measures ======================================================= Protective Gloves: GENERAL PURPOSE Eye Protection: SAFETY GLASSES Other Protective Equipment: LAB COAT Work Hygienic Practices: WASH THOROUGHLY AFTER HANDLING. Supplemental Safety and Health: ORAL LD50 INFORMATION IS FOR POTASSIUM IODIDE. ======================================================= Physical/Chemical Properties ======================================================= B.P. Text: 212F Vapor Pres: 17 Vapor Density: 0.6 Spec Gravity: 1.01 PH: 11.8 Solubility in Water: COMPLETE Appearance and Odor: CLEAR, COLORLESS LIQUID W/NO ODOR. Percent Volatiles by Volume: 99 ======================================================= Reactivity Data ======================================================= Stability Indicator: YES Stability Condition To Avoid: EXTREME HEAT/TEMPS, DIRECT SUNLIGHT. Materials To Avoid: ACIDS. Hazardous Decomposition Products: ELEMENATL IODINE, POTASSIUM OXIDE.
